Staff Software Engineer

Há 15 horas


Jundiaí, Brasil Shape Digital Tempo inteiro

Join to apply for the Staff Software Engineer role at Shape Digital3 weeks ago Be among the first 25 applicantsJoin to apply for the Staff Software Engineer role at Shape DigitalGet AI-powered advice on this job and more exclusive features.The Staff Software Engineer is responsible for designing, building, and evolving software systems that are robust, scalable, and aligned with the company's strategic objectives.As a Staff Software Engineer, the goal is to identify the most appropriate technical solution for each problem.Sometimes the best approach may be a well-architected existing library or service, while other times it may require designing new systems from the ground up.A high level of technical rigor is expected, with well-documented designs, reproducible results, and reliable systems.It is also expected that you stay updated with software engineering best practices, architectural patterns, and emerging technologies, while effectively incorporating domain knowledge into the solutions you build.Solutions are expected to be developed end-to-end, from design and prototyping to production deployment and long-term maintenance, always meeting high engineering standards.You will also know when to build versus buy, ensuring accelerated value delivery.The Staff Software Engineer is, above all, a pragmatic problem-solver, technical leader, and a core contributor to the success of all products developed by Shape Digital.Responsibilities:Explore and identify opportunities to improve and evolve the company's software architecture and platform foundations.Write and guide others to write high-quality, scalable, secure, and maintainable code following best practices.Partner with product managers, designers, and domain experts to translate business needs into technical solutions.Lead the design and development of complex software systems, ensuring they meet performance, security, and reliability requirements.Manage the technical backlog, balancing short-term deliverables with long-term architectural evolution.Mentor senior engineers and influence across multiple teams, driving adoption of engineering excellence and best practices.Ensure software systems follow rigorous quality standards, including testing, monitoring, and documentation.Stay current with emerging technologies, frameworks, and architectural paradigms, applying them when they create business value.Contribute to technical strategy, architectural decision-making, and long-term technology vision.Requirements:A degree in Computer Science, Engineering, or a related STEM field.Strong proficiency in one or more programming languages (e.g., Python, Java, C#, Go, or similar).Proven experience in designing and maintaining large-scale, distributed, or mission-critical systems.Solid understanding of software architecture, system design, and design patterns.Experience with CI/CD pipelines, DevOps practices, and modern software delivery methodologies.Familiarity with databases (SQL and NoSQL) and cloud-native architectures.Advanced/Fluent English.Differentials:Knowledge of industrial or enterprise-scale systems.Experience with Cloud platforms: Azure, AWS, or Google Cloud Platform.Hands-on experience with infrastructure-as-code, observability stacks, and security best practices.Contributions to open-source projects, technical publications, or patents.Benefits:PPR (Profit Sharing): Possibility of extra compensation based on the company's results, according to your performance.Health and Dental Plan: To ensure your care and well-beingFlexible Benefit: Receive an amount that can be used according to your needs, including food, transportation, education, culture, and health.You decide how to use itFlexible Hours: Work at the best time for you and have a better quality of life.Massages and Manicure in the Office: So you can relax and feel good about yourself.Mentorship Program: Access development opportunities with the help of experienced professionals.Gympass: To keep your health in check and take care of your body.Snacks in the Office: Because everyone loves a snack at workInclusive Environment: We value diversity and always strive to create a space where everyone can be authentic, respected, and feel part of something bigger.Day off in Your Birthday Month: A day off in your birthday month to celebrate in any way you preferExtended Maternity/Paternity Leave: So you can enjoy this important time with your family, with peace of mind that your professional life will remain well-supported.Childcare Assistance: To support you with the care of your young children.Continuous Individualized Development Support: We offer support for your professional growth, respecting your personal needs and goals.Culture and Well-being: We create an environment that values mental health, work-life balance, and encourages connection with culture.The benefits provided with this position are not deducted from your paycheckSeniority levelSeniority levelMid-Senior levelEmployment typeEmployment typeFull-timeJob functionJob functionEngineering and Information TechnologyIndustriesSoftware DevelopmentReferrals increase your chances of interviewing at Shape Digital by 2xGet notified about new Staff Software Engineer jobs in Brazil.Desenvolvedor Front-end | Front-end Developer - RemotoJoinville, Santa Catarina, Brazil 6 months agoFull Stack Software Engineer | Júnior | React + PHP + Node (CLT) - RemotoDesenvolvedor(a) Full-Stack (Python + Next.js) — PlenoWe're unlocking community knowledge in a new way.Experts add insights directly into each article, started with the help of AI.#J-*****-Ljbffr



  • Jundiaí, Brasil QuintoAndar Tempo inteiro

    Grupo QuintoAndar | Staff Software Engineer Join to apply for the Grupo QuintoAndar | Staff Software Engineer role at QuintoAndar About Grupo QuintoAndar We are Grupo QuintoAndar, the largest real estate ecosystem in Latin America. Guided by a shared purpose of helping people love where they live, we have a diversified portfolio of brands and solutions...


  • Jundiaí, Brasil Canonical Tempo inteiro

    Join to apply for the Senior/Staff/Principal Engineer role at Canonical3 days ago Be among the first 25 applicantsJoin to apply for the Senior/Staff/Principal Engineer role at CanonicalCanonical is a leading provider of open source software and operating systems to the global enterprise and technology markets.Our platform, Ubuntu, is very widely used in...


  • Jundiaí, Brasil Nearsure Tempo inteiro

    Staff Software Development Test Engineer - Work from homeJoin our close-knit LATAM remote team: Connect through fun activities like coffee breaks, tech talks, and games with your team-mates and management.Say goodbye to micromanagement!We champion autonomy, open communication, and respect for diversity as our core values.Your well-being matters: Our People...


  • Jundiaí, Brasil LEDN Tempo inteiro

    Overview Join to apply for the Staff Application Security Engineer role at LEDN . Ledn is a global financial services company built for digital assets, helping to improve the everyday lives of Bitcoin holders while building generational wealth for the future. We offer egalitarian lending, savings and trading products to digital asset holders in over 150...


  • Jundiaí, Brasil LEDN Tempo inteiro

    Join to apply for the Staff Application Security Engineer role at LEDN The Opportunity We are seeking a full-time Staff Application Security Engineer with deep expertise in Application Security, Identity & Access Management, and Confidential Computing to strengthen the security of our Bitcoin-backed loan platform. Security is fundamental to protecting our...

  • Software Engineer

    Há 2 dias


    Jundiaí, Brasil Microsoft Tempo inteiro

    Join to apply for the Software Engineer - M365 role at Microsoft About Microsoft 365 We are hiring multiple Software Engineers to join the Microsoft 365 team. These are remote positions, allowing you to work from the comfort of your home! The Microsoft 365 team is looking for software engineers to help design and build one of the fastest-growing cloud...

  • Software Engineer

    2 semanas atrás


    Jundiaí, Brasil Canonical Tempo inteiro

    Software Engineer - Solutions EngineeringJoin to apply for the Software Engineer - Solutions Engineering role at CanonicalSoftware Engineer - Solutions Engineering2 days ago Be among the first 25 applicantsJoin to apply for the Software Engineer - Solutions Engineering role at CanonicalGet AI-powered advice on this job and more exclusive features.Canonical...


  • Jundiaí, Brasil Canonical Tempo inteiro

    Join or sign in to find your next jobJoin to apply for the Linux devices software engineer - snapd role at Canonical3 days ago Be among the first 25 applicantsJoin to apply for the Linux devices software engineer - snapd role at CanonicalGet AI-powered advice on this job and more exclusive features.Canonical is a leading provider of open source software and...


  • Jundiaí, Brasil Epam Systems Tempo inteiro

    1 day ago Be among the first 25 applicantsWe are seeking a highly skilled Lead Data Software Engineer to join our remote team, working with a global leader in banking and financial services.With a legacy of over 70 years, this bank offers a wide range of services, including financing and leasing, foreign exchange, and investment banking.As a Lead Data...

  • Software Engineer

    2 semanas atrás


    Jundiaí, Brasil Canonical Tempo inteiro

    Job Overview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is very wid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. The company is founder-led, profitable, and growing. This is an...